Which payment methods do Payrexx and Worldline offer?

Both providers support the most important payment methods: credit cards, TWINT, PostFinance Pay, Apple Pay and Google Pay. Additionally, Payrexx offers Samsung Pay, WIR Pay, Centi and Pay by Bank – four methods that are not available with Worldline. Worldline supports Reka, as does Payrexx. For merchants who want to offer their customers the maximum possible choice of payment methods, Payrexx has a clear lead with 16 compared to 12 supported methods.

How do the integrations of Payrexx and Worldline differ?

Payrexx offers free plugins for all popular shop systems, including Shopify, WooCommerce, Shopware, MyCommerce, JTL, and Ecwid. With Worldline, some plugins are subject to a fee, and there is no integration for Shopify and Ecwid. In addition, Payrexx offers integrated e-commerce tools (payment links, QR Pay, mini webshop) that are completely missing from Worldline. Worldline's offering is aimed more at larger companies with individual requirements.

How is the support at Payrexx and Worldline?

Payrexx offers personal support with direct contact persons in Switzerland, including advice for SMEs. Worldline relies on a paid support hotline - a disadvantage especially for smaller businesses. The Google reviews confirm this difference: Payrexx has 3.9 stars (155 reviews), Worldline 2.9 stars (674 reviews).

For whom is Payrexx suitable and for whom Worldline?

Payrexx is the right choice for SMEs and growing online shops looking for a cost-effective solution with a wide range of features and personal support. Worldline is better suited for larger companies that require omnichannel solutions (online + POS) and are willing to pay accordingly for tailored support.

Which provider is easier for you to set up – Payrexx or Worldline?

Payrexx is quick to get started as a payment facilitator with a single contract and no setup costs. Verification takes place on the same day. Although Worldline also offers an e-commerce package without monthly fixed costs, setting up individual or larger solutions requires direct contact with sales. For SMEs that want to start quickly, Payrexx is the more uncomplicated way.

Additional remarks
Payrexx

Payrexx is especially easy to set up as a Payment Facilitator – no programming knowledge is required. For verification, a valid photo ID and, where applicable, a trade register number are required. If you register by 4 pm, the review takes place on the same day. Start-ups receive a 30% discount, and non-profit organisations benefit from a 50% reduction on transaction fees.

Worldline

At Worldline, transaction fees are not always fully transparent – individual terms must be requested from sales. For support enquiries, a paid hotline is used. In addition to e-commerce packages, Worldline also offers a combined package with Wix for merchants who want to build an online shop at the same time.
